Iheanacho Tells Sierra Leone Poster Boy Kei Kamara Super Eagles Are On A Revenge Mission
Published: November 17, 2020
Leicester City striker Kelechi Iheanacho has warned the poster boy of the Sierra Leone National Team, Kei Kamara that the Super Eagles are on a revenge mission in Tuesday evening's 2021 Africa Cup of Nations qualifier at the Siaka Stevens Stadium.
The Super Eagles are seeking to salvage their dented reputation in today's clash after surrendering a four-goal lead last Friday at the Samuel Ogbemudia Stadium.
Iheanacho and Kamara had a conversation during training at the National Stadium in Sierra Leone on Monday evening and the Super Eagle informed the Minnesota United frontman that they mean business.
In a video circulating on social media, Iheanacho said in Pidgin English: "Una try but we no go mercy for una here. We vex come, we dey vex."
Kamara replied : "This na Freetown, we don't lose in Freetown, I tell you this now".
Iheanacho responded : "Everything is free in Freetown".
With Napoli striker Victor Osimhen out through injury, Iheanacho is battling Belgian-based duo Emmanuel Dennis and Paul Onuachu for the center forward position against Sierra Leone.
In seven previous visits to Sierra Leone, Nigeria have won two matches, drawn three and lost on two occasions.
